2 OdpowiedziIf all six capture the initial spawn, that'll get you max points for it, then if you all rush for the middle, you can take out those two that left their team on their first flag. You'll have a few seconds to kill, capture and prepare for the rest of their team due to their initial flag taking longer to capture because two ran straight past. That way, you'll be in the lead with two zones. Just hope your teammates aren't totally retarded and try to capture the third.

One thing I've noticed that I'm not sure a lot of players have is that, upon capturing a flag, points are awarded according to how many players are on the flag. In other words, if Alpha team has 6 players capture a flag, while Bravo has 5 capture a flag, Alpha will score more points than Bravo for the capture. So, it may be better to score as many points as possible on the initial capture than to have one or two players rush B and get nuked. However, if they manage to capture B, I suppose that is ultimately more advantageous.
